Explore "undiscovered" southern Africa, from the prolific game haunts of South Africa and Botswana to tranquil Zimbabwe and the Zambezi River.  Chartered aircraft whisk travelers from one unique destination to another.  Using small chartered aircraft allows fast and easy access to places that would otherwise require long hours of driving along dusty, bumpy roads.

Entering Botswana you feel as though you have gone back a hundred years to share the discovery of a truly virgin Africa as Livingstone and Stanley once did. Botswana is a land of contrasts, ranging from the arid desert to the fertile flood plain to the rich game reserves of Moremi Game Reserve.

Fly to Maun, Botswana and then on to Eagle Island Camp. Regarded as one of the world’s most beautiful camps, Eagle Island Camp awaits you deep within the Okavango Delta, a rich swampland that supports an incredible variety of plants and wildlife. One of the area’s most pristine natural locations, it lies on the banks of the Boro Channel just south of Chief’s Island. Unspoiled and remote, the camp is shaded by a canopy of indigenous trees offering the perfect retreat from the blazing African heat. As the sun begins to dip into the horizon, the camp’s sunset cruiser takes you on a magnificent journey through the delta. You can enjoy the birds, watch elephants bathing and mammoth hippos emerging from the water before you return to the base. There you are welcomed with a wonderful candlelight dinner served under the stars.

Your next stop is the luxurious Khwai River Lodge. Surrounded by indigenous Leadwood and fig trees, your accommodations at the Khwai River Lodge are among the most distinguished safari lodges in all of Botswana. A charter flight will bring you to this magical location. The exquisite natural habitat of Khwai makes it a regular host to elephant, buffalo, lion, leopard, cheetah and wild dogs. Early morning and late afternoon game drives take advantage of ideal conditions for viewing the wildlife. We set out in open four-wheel-drive vehicles and also take walking tours led by the experienced team of guides. Night drives and stargazing presentations are conducted after dinner.

On to the Savute Elephant Camp. Perched on the former banks of the now dry Savute Channel, the Savute Elephant Camp is often referred to as the “elephant capital of the world,” offering a spectacular bird’s-eye view of elephants in their natural environment with an adjacent watering hole just meters away from the camp’s main building. Activities include daily game drives in open vehicles and game viewing from a number of great hiding spots. Delight in the culinary pleasures to be found here as well. The Savute offers a dining experience second to none, including dining in the boma within the heart of a true “bush” environment.

Next stop Victoria Falls. Visit to the Livingstone Museum, the country’s biggest and oldest museum, dating back to the 1930’s. In addition to exhibitions on human evolution, the period of British rule and subsequent independence, the museum also houses a large collection of David Livingstone memorabilia, donated by the Livingstone family. Afterwards, we’ll make a special stop at the Maramba Cultural Center, an authentic tribal village to get a firsthand sense of traditional village life. A well-marked and paved path is your invitation to explore the nearby rainforest environs. Your stay in Livingstone will cap your adventure as you explore beautiful Victoria Falls. Described by the Kololo tribe living in the area in the 1800’s as Mosi-oa-Tunya, “the Smoke that Thunders,” Victoria Falls offers a spectacular sight of awe inspiring beauty and grandeur on the Zambezi River. As you relax on the sundeck of the five-star Royal Livingstone Hotel, overlooking the forest and the Zambezi, rainbows fill the air, creating a truly enchanting atmosphere. Enjoy a thrilling a helicopter ride above the falls for a spectacular end to this extraordinary journey.
